WDS

Jason Weber

1998



Chapter 1: Overview

1.1: Notice

1.2: Purpose

1.3: Design

1.4: Features

1.4.1: Platform Dependencies Completely Abstracted Out by EW

1.4.2: Derived Functionality

1.4.3: Dynamic Inheritable Look-And-Feel

1.4.4: Dynamic Hierarchial Arrangement

1.4.5: Layered Scoping with Event Bypassing

1.4.6: Widget Ties

1.4.7: Tool Tips

1.4.8: Online Help

1.4.9: No Unusual Dependencies

1.4.10: Widget Types

1.4.10.1: Implemented

1.4.10.2: Proposed or Not Current

1.4.10.3: Related Classes

1.5: WDS Screen Shots

1.6: Notes

Chapter 2: Window and Widget Sizing

2.1: Introduction

2.2: Normal Sizing

2.2.1: SetGeometry()

2.2.2: Resize()

2.3: Bounding

2.4: Widget Auto-sizing (from self)

2.5: Node Auto-sizing (from children)

2.6: Form Auto-sizing

2.7: Form-based Centering and Uniformity